    Gloucester is a city in Essex County, Massachusetts, located on the Cape Ann Peninsula along the Atlantic coast. After arriving in Gloucester, we began exploring iconic locations featured in movies and TV shows along the shoreline. Our first stop was the fishing port pier—the very seaport where Ruby set off to chase her dreams in the film CODA (Hearing Girl).

    Manchester-by-the-Sea, Massachusetts, is located on the southern side of Cape Ann, where the peninsula meets the mainland. Known for its picturesque beaches and charming streetscapes, the town is also famous as the primary filming location for the movie Manchester by the Sea. Many key scenes—such as Lee Chandler’s home and various town streets—were filmed right here.
